The aerospace fastener industry focuses on manufacturing components that secure various aircraft parts and systems. Companies offer a wide range of fasteners, including bolts, rivets, and specialty items, all designed to meet rigorous safety standards. As demands for lightweight materials and enhanced performance grow, the sector is innovating with new materials and advanced technologies. Moreover, sustainability concerns are prompting manufacturers to consider eco-friendly practices, further driving industry transformations. The future of aerospace fasteners looks toward improved efficiency, reliability, and compliance with evolving regulations that ensure the safety of air travel.

Cherry Aerospace, a SPS Technologies Company, is a manufacturer based in Santa Ana, California, specializing in aerospace fastening systems. Established in 1940, the company has built a reputation for producing high-quality blind rivets and installation tools that cater to the needs of aircraft manufacturers and repair facilities. Their product offerings include the well-known CherryMAX® rivets, which are widely used in the industry for their reliability and performance. Cherry Aerospace focuses on enhancing efficiency and safety in aircraft assembly and maintenance, ensuring that their fastening solutions meet stringent aerospace standards. The company operates globally, distributing its products through authorized distributors, and maintains a commitment to quality assurance and customer support. With a workforce of around 149 employees, Cherry Aerospace continues to play a significant role in the aerospace fastener market.

Skybolt Aerospace Fasteners, based in Leesburg, Florida, has been a key player in the aerospace fastener market since its inception in 1982. The company specializes in manufacturing high-quality fastening solutions tailored for the aerospace and automotive racing sectors. Their product lineup includes innovative fasteners like the CLoc® 2000 and ALoc® Aircraft Series, which are designed to meet the rigorous demands of safety and performance in aviation. Skybolt is particularly noted for its development of Skytanium®, a lightweight yet strong material that significantly reduces weight while maintaining compliance with industry standards. The company has a robust patent portfolio, reflecting its commitment to innovation and quality. Skybolt's clientele includes notable aerospace manufacturers and racing teams, underscoring its importance in these industries. With a dedicated team and a focus on customer service, Skybolt continues to contribute to advancements in aerospace fastening technology.

TFI Aerospace Corporation, based in Orangeville, Ontario, Canada, has been a manufacturer of specialty fasteners since its inception in 1991. The company caters to the aerospace, transportation, and industrial sectors, providing high-quality fasteners that meet rigorous specifications. TFI Aerospace serves a variety of clients, including manufacturers of commercial and military aircraft, as well as producers of automotive and industrial equipment. Their product range includes high-stress bolts, screws, rivets, and T-bolts, crafted from advanced materials such as A-286 super alloy stainless steel and lightweight titanium. TFI Aerospace is recognized for its ability to produce fasteners that comply with several industry standards, including NAS, NASM, MS, LN, and AN. Their commitment to quality is underscored by their certifications in AS9100 and ISO 9001:2015, ensuring that their products meet the stringent demands of critical applications.

West Coast Aerospace, Inc. is a manufacturer based in Carson, California, specializing in precision-engineered fasteners for military and commercial aircraft. Established in 1978, the company has built a reputation for quality and reliability in the aerospace sector. They offer a wide array of aerospace components, including their proprietary Hi-Lok™ and Hi-Tigue™ fasteners. With a vast inventory of over 50 million parts covering more than 30,000 line items, West Coast Aerospace caters to the needs of major OEM airframe producers and MRO markets worldwide. The company operates multiple facilities in Southern California, utilizing advanced manufacturing technologies and high-quality raw materials. Their quality assurance processes comply with the latest AS9100 standards, ensuring that their products meet the stringent requirements of the aerospace industry. West Coast Aerospace has received accolades for their performance from notable clients, including Boeing and Lockheed Martin, highlighting their commitment to excellence in service and product delivery.

Long-Lok Fasteners Corporation, based in Cincinnati, Ohio, has been a prominent player in the fastener manufacturing industry since its inception in 1956. The company specializes in engineered fasteners, particularly self-locking and self-sealing fasteners, which are essential for the aerospace and defense industries. Long-Lok's product offerings include a variety of fasteners designed to withstand extreme temperatures and vibrations, ensuring reliability in critical applications. The company engages directly with customers, providing quotes and technical support tailored to their specific needs. As part of the Novaria Group, Long-Lok benefits from a network of precision component companies, enhancing its capabilities and market presence in the aerospace sector.

Heartland Precision Fasteners, Inc., founded in 1994 and based in New Century, Kansas, is a manufacturer dedicated to producing high-grade, precision aerospace fasteners. The company offers a variety of products, including bolts and screws, and provides essential engineering and heat treatment services. Heartland serves a clientele that includes prominent aerospace manufacturers, ensuring that their fasteners meet rigorous industry standards. They are known for their exceptional quality control processes and impressive on-time delivery rates, often exceeding 95%. Heartland's manufacturing capabilities include cold and warm heading, hot forging, and various finishing processes, allowing them to maintain tight tolerances on their products. Their involvement in the aerospace sector is further highlighted by their participation in industry committees and their commitment to continuous improvement, as evidenced by numerous awards and recognitions from major clients. Heartland's in-house heat treatment and chemical processing capabilities also contribute to their efficiency and reliability in fulfilling customer orders.
